there is opaqueness;
a lack of clarity and
a force that melts tundra
in gentle breaths ~
shushed...
as relentless
as it is warm;
frigidity relinquishes
to her sirocco breeze;
the smell of tall pines
and the gentle headiness of
lost lucidity...
a levanto plays allegretto
across mountain spines,
and warm winds paint
lilac
as blossoms
on hushed lips...
